Sat 406974566530521

decimal
81394.4566530521
degree
0°81394′754″4566530521‴
percentile
19.379741284675866%
name
kyugzmuezwa
cycle
0
epoch
0
period
40
block
81394
offset
4566530521
timestamp
rarity
common